uPVC windows can have problems opening or locking. This problem usually occurs when the locking system is stiff or sluggish. If this is the case, an easy fix is to apply graphite powder or machine oil to grease the lock and handle mechanism. This will allow for the mechanism to be released and the door or window to function as normal.

The hinges may become stiff or even stuck. This is usually caused by grit and dust that build on the hinges. Lubricating the hinges with grease or oil is the solution. If you use the wrong oil, however, could lead to damage and may cause the hinges to become unusable.

Repairs to stained glass

Stained glass windows are found in churches, homes and other structures. They add visual interest, privacy and light to an area. They can be fragile and require regular maintenance to ensure they are in good shape. Even with the best treatment stained glass and lead windows will deteriorate due to age as well as exposure to the elements and weather factors. This can cause a variety of problems such as cracks, fade and water leakage. It is crucial to locate a local expert to restore your stained or stained window to its original beauty.

The cost of repairing cracked or broken stained-glass is $500. The price will vary based on the solution needed to fix the issue. A professional might employ epoxy edge-gluing or copper foil to repair the broken glass. They can also re-lead the lead cames, and then reseal the stained glass. There are many options to choose from and each comes with advantages and disadvantages. The best solution depends on the size, location, and type of glass used.

Cracks in the leaded glass may be caused by thermal expansion, vibrations or contraction building movements, or normal wear and tear. Over time, the cracks can grow and cause more problems. To avoid further damage and enlargement any crack that crosses an important part of stained-glass panels or the face should be repaired as quickly as is possible. Years ago, this was typically accomplished by splicing a "Dutchman" lead flange on top of the crack. This technique was a poor solution, and now there are much better methods to repair these kinds of cracks.

Stained glass restoration can take on many varieties. It can be as easy as repairing cracks, or as difficult as restoring a whole stained glass window or door panel back to its original condition. In general, the price for a complete restoration is more expensive than an easy repair. This is due to the fact that the process involves cleaning and removing damaged or stained glass, tightening the lead cames, sealing and re-tying the cement and replacing missing pieces of stained glass.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ping blocks air and water from entering homes through the gaps around windows and doors. It's an essential element of home maintenance and can prevent the need for costly repairs or energy bills, as in making homes more comfortable. However the materials used to make this seal can deteriorate over time due to wear and tear, upvc window repairs near me making it important to replace the seals from time to time.

There are several signs that your weather stripping is beginning to wear out: a wet area after washing the windows; a whistling sound when driving along the street drafts that are felt when you walk through an unlocked door. All of these are indicators that you should find a Tasker near me who offers weatherstripping repairs.

Taskers can protect your doors and windows by using a variety of weatherstripping materials. Foam tapes are made of open-cell or closed cell foam. They come in different dimensions, widths, and thicknesses. These are easy to install and can be cut with scissors. Felt strips are also inexpensive and typically last up to a year. They can be cut to length with scissors and attached to the door frame or hinge side of a sliding or double-hung window with glue, staples or tacks. Vinyl or metal V strips are a little more difficult to put in, but they can be attached to the window jamb.

One of the most common issues that occur with double-paned windows is fogging of the glass. This is caused by a failure of the airtight seal between the two glass panes. Re-sealing the glass could be able to fix the problem, depending on the cause. If, however, the window has been exposed to elements for an extended period of time, it may be necessary to replace the entire unit.
